HamburgerMenu
iimjobs
Job Views:  
685
Applications:  394
Recruiter Actions:  6

Job Code

1640354

Description:

Role Overview:

Were looking for a Brand Marketing Director to lead the strategy, positioning, and marketing communications.

This is a senior strategic role responsible for building the brand, driving awareness, and strengthening its reputation in India and global markets.

You'll work closely with leadership and cross-functional teams to define the brand story, manage campaigns, and position as a top-tier digital marketing partner.

Key Responsibilities:

Brand Strategy & Positioning:

- Develop and own the overall brand strategy defining voice, tone, visual identity, and market positioning.

- Strengthen brand equity across owned, earned, and paid channels.

- Conduct competitive benchmarking and audience research to refine positioning.

Marketing Communications:

- Oversee content, PR, events, and digital marketing efforts aimed at brand awareness.

- Develop and execute integrated campaigns (digital, social, events, media, etc.) to promote thought leadership and service capabilities.

- Collaborate with internal teams to ensure all external communication reflects the brands voice and values.

Thought Leadership & PR:

- Build visibility through media partnerships, award submissions, industry reports, and executive profiling.

- Manage PR agencies and relationships with journalists and publications.

- Drive content-led campaigns highlighting success stories, innovations, and client impact.

Performance & Measurement:

- Define KPIs for brand marketing efforts awareness, engagement, share of voice, and lead contribution.

- Use analytics and reporting to measure and optimize campaign performance.

Leadership & Collaboration:

- Lead and mentor a marketing team including content, design, PR, and social media professionals.

- Work cross-functionally with sales, delivery, and HR to ensure brand consistency across touchpoints (e.g., employer branding, client communications, recruitment marketing).

Brand Marketing Operations:

- Ensuring smooth functioning of brand content operations

- Ensuring Video Production & Marketing operations

Qualifications & Experience:

- 10-15 years of experience in brand marketing, corporate communications, or integrated marketing roles.

- Experience in digital marketing, advertising, or technology sectors preferred.

- Proven track record of managing multi-channel marketing campaigns and building brand equity.

- Strong storytelling, creative, and analytical skills.

- Excellent leadership and communication abilities.

Must-Have Skills:

- Brand strategy development and execution

- Integrated marketing campaign management

- Public relations and media handling

- Data-driven marketing decision-making

- Team leadership and stakeholder management

Didn’t find the job appropriate? Report this Job

Job Views:  
685
Applications:  394
Recruiter Actions:  6

Job Code

1640354

UPSKILL YOURSELF

My Learning Centre

Explore CoursesArrow